Academic Overview

The 2022 tuition & fees is $27,786 for undergraduate students. The school offers both undergraduate and graduate programs and a total of 6,769 students are enrolled. The acceptance rate of undergraduate school is 95.64% and the graduation rate is 51% last year.
The salary after graduation from Columbia College Chicago varies by major programs where the average earning after 10 years is $39,200. You can check the average salary by the major programs on the area of study page.

Key Academic Statistics
The following chart illustrates the 2022 key academic statistics at Columbia College Chicago. The acceptance rate of Columbia College Chicago is 95.64% and the yield (enrollment rate) is 24.57%. The average graduation rate is 51% and no students have transferred out from the school.
The average received amount of financial aid is $12,540 and 87% of undergraduate students received grants or scholarship aid. A total of 6,769 students is attending including both undergraduate and graduate students, and the student to faculty ratio is 14 to 1.

Offered Degrees
Columbia College Chicago offers 71 major programs on-site (in-person class) only. The following table lists the number of programs by offered degree with online class availabilities.
Award Level | Total Number of Programs | Available Online Class |
---|---|---|
Bachelor's Degree | 55 | 0 |
Post Bachelor's Degree | 1 | 0 |
Master's Degree | 15 | 0 |
